我使用twilio来分享我的用户的联系信息。我已经这样做了6个月,没有任何问题。
最近,我开始收到联系卡不能通过的bug报告。iOS将其作为一个未知附件接收,文件名为'text_0.x-vcard‘,请参阅屏幕截图
我无法在我的设备上重现这段视频--我从使用iPhone 7、iPhone 6和iPhone 5的用户那里收到了这方面的报告--没有一致的信息。操作系统也没有一致性。vcf文件是有效的,它适用于90%的用户。

有什么想法吗?这是一个vcf文件的例子-在我的手机上工作,不能在其他设备上工作。
BEGIN:VCARD
VERSION:3.0
N:Doe;John;;;
FN:John Doe
ORG:Example.com Inc.;
TITLE:Imaginary test person
EMAIL;type=INTERNET;type=WORK;type=pref:johnDoe@example.org
TEL;type=WORK;type=pref:+1 617 555 1212
TEL;type=WORK:+1 (617) 555-1234
TEL;type=CELL:+1 781 555 1212
TEL;type=HOME:+1 202 555 1212
item1.ADR;type=WORK:;;2 Enterprise Avenue;Worktown;NY;01111;USA
item1.X-ABADR:us
item2.ADR;type=HOME;type=pref:;;3 Acacia Avenue;Hoemtown;MA;02222;USA
item2.X-ABADR:us
NOTE:John Doe has a long and varied history\, being documented on more police files that anyone else. Reports of his death are alas numerous.
item3.URL;type=pref:http\://www.example/com/doe
item3.X-ABLabel:_$!<HomePage>!$_
item4.URL:http\://www.example.com/Joe/foaf.df
item4.X-ABLabel:FOAF
item5.X-ABRELATEDNAMES;type=pref:Jane Doe
item5.X-ABLabel:_$!<Friend>!$_
CATEGORIES:Work,Test group
X-ABUID:5AD380FD-B2DE-4261-BA99-DE1D1DB52FBE\:ABPerson
END:VCARD发布于 2017-08-11 03:06:40
Steph,我是Stack Exchange的新手,所以我不知道如何发送这封邮件。您在上面显示了您的Twilio数字之一。
我看到了类似的问题,我相信这都与你的内容类型有关。尝试一个
curl --head <your vcard web address>
我唯一一次让它为我工作是在它返回的时候
Content-Type: text/x-vcard; charset=utf-8; name="fileName.vcf"我不知道这个链接会持续多久,但试着发送这个电子名片VCF File (从http地址发送),它适用于我的Twilio与iOS 10.3.3
我想你是对的,它与安全性有关;为什么你想要一个'text/html‘文件像'text/x-vcard’文件一样被执行。我认为内部标头修饰符不会起作用,请让我知道。
https://stackoverflow.com/questions/43142920
复制相似问题